Transaction 58ea91701e165323536565fa73ec3ca833fb729cbcd349e8b8a9f4a51e6dfaca

1 Input
2 Outputs
  • 58ea91701e165323536565fa73ec3ca833fb729cbcd349e8b8a9f4a51e6dfaca:0
  • value  2540638
    address  1LF4NgMX5uECRzrmLtaWQjXz7iqAMoLdra
  • 58ea91701e165323536565fa73ec3ca833fb729cbcd349e8b8a9f4a51e6dfaca:1
  • value  17389824
    address  3HNgzsuFRCcV81HhgepnxXMcWvR45fPM1S